Trump legal news brief: Billionaire Don Hankey’s company covers Trump’s $175 million fraud trial bond

New York financial fraud

Knight Specialty Insurance pays Trump’s $175 million fraud trial bond

Key players: Knight Specialty Insurance CEO Don Hankey, Judge Arthur Engoron, New York Attorney General Letitia James, Trump attorney Alina Habba

  • On Monday, the Knight Specialty Insurance Co. loaned Trump $175 million to cover his bond in the civil financial fraud trial, Bloomberg reported. The company is owned by Hankey, who said he approached Trump about the loan.
  • “This is what we do at Knight Insurance, and we’re happy to do this for anyone who needs a bond,” Hankey told the Associated Press.
  • Last month, a New York appeals court judge lowered the bond amount from $464 million (110% of Egoron’s judgment) to $175 million after Trump’s lawyers said they had been turned down by 30 lenders to secure the higher amount.
  • “Yes, I voted for him in the past, but this is a business deal and this is what we do,” Hankey said of the loan, which, he added, Trump secured using cash as collateral.
  • By posting the $175 million bond, Trump prevents James from seizing his assets while he appeals Engoron’s judgment.
  • The New York state Appellate Division has said it would hear arguments in September.
  • If Trump wins on appeal, he will get the bond amount back. If he loses, he will immediately owe the rest of the original judgment plus the interest accrued since the date of the Engoron’s original ruling.

Why it matters: While Trump indicated during the financial fraud trial that he had nearly half a billion in cash reserves, he told the appeals court judge that he wanted to keep that free to use for the 2024 presidential campaign. Having secured a loan from Hankey’s company, he is now free, at least for the meantime, to spend it on that.
